1. Install "libmate-menu2" package

Please follow the instructions below to install libmate-menu2 on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libmate-menu2

2. Uninstall "libmate-menu2" package

In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to uninstall libmate-menu2 on Debian 11 (Bullseye):

$ sudo apt remove libmate-menu2 $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
